Damaged Roof Repair Cost Overview

Typical low-high price ranges for damaged roof repair vary based on the extent of damage, roof size, and materials. Small repairs may be more affordable, while extensive damage can increase costs.

$300 - $1,500: Minor repairs such as patching small leaks or replacing a few shingles

$2,000 - $8,000: Moderate repairs involving larger sections or more extensive damage

Project Type Typical Range
Shingle Replacement $300 - $1,200
Leak Repair $400 - $2,000
Roof Section Replacement $1,000 - $4,500
Flashing Repair $200 - $800
Gutter and Roof Edge Repair $300 - $1,200
Full Roof Restoration $5,000 - $15,000

What affects the cost of damaged roof repair

Understanding the factors that influence repair costs can help in planning and budgeting for roof damage restoration. Several key elements can impact the overall expense of a damaged roof repair project.

  • Materials used: The type and quality of roofing materials can significantly affect costs, with higher-end or specialty materials generally being more expensive.
  • Size and scope of damage: Larger or more extensive damage requires more materials and labor, increasing the overall cost.
  • Labor complexity: Difficult access, steep slopes, or intricate roof designs can increase the complexity and time required for repairs.
  • Permitting requirements: Some repairs may necessitate permits, which can add to the total project expenses due to fees and inspection processes.
  • Additional services or extras: Items such as waterproofing, flashing replacement, or debris removal can add to the overall cost of repair projects.
Cost by size or scope for Damaged Roof Repair
Scope/Size Typical Range
Small area (e.g., single section) $1,000 - $3,000
Moderate area (e.g., half the roof) $3,000 - $7,000
Large area (e.g., entire roof) $7,000 - $20,000
Extensive damage (e.g., multiple sections or structural repairs) $20,000 - $50,000+
